**Handover: Tessellar Timetable Solver**

Welcome aboard. The solver core lives in the scheduler-engine repo; constraints are encoded as weighted clauses fed into the Briarholt SAT layer. Known issue: double-booked labs when a teacher spans two campuses — the workaround is the campus-split preprocessor, which must run before every solve. Benchmarks take about forty minutes; run them before merging constraint changes. Config for the Northvale pilot school is frozen until term end. Direct all escalations to the engineer named below.

account owner for bawip-tahag: Raleth Quenok

## Step 2: Fix reconnect storm

The old Wrenlet client retried websocket connections with no jitter, causing thundering-herd reconnects after any broker restart. Version 4.2 adds exponential backoff with jitter and a reconnect cap. Upgrade all clients before restarting brokers, or the storm recurs. Old retry keys are ignored silently — remove them to avoid confusion. Set the client to the following values.

settings of fafog-haduf:
ZORIX_PIN=4648
ZORIX_METRICS_HOST=metrics.zorix.paliqsys.corp
ZORIX_LOG_LEVEL=info
ZORIX_TENANT=druix

// TAIL_WINDOW_DEFAULT controls how many trailing lines the
// `murkwatch tail` subcommand fetches per poll. Reviewers: this was
// lowered from 500 to 200 after the Fennelgate incident, where large
// windows saturated the relay during rotation. Changing it requires
// sign-off from the observability group. The build token this default
// was validated against appears below.

build token for kagaf-hahof: htk14_9d3d4d26d7d8de